2023 Men's Volleyball Season Preview

2023 Men's Volleyball Season Preview

Chicago, Ill. - On January 12, the Northern Athletics Collegiate Conference (NACC) released the men’s volleyball preseason poll for the 2023 season. Illinois Tech was picked to finish in 8th place with 151 points. Aurora University sits at the top of the rankings, receiving 9 first place votes and 310 points. 

The Illinois Tech Scarlet Hawks men’s volleyball team returns to the court on January 18th when they host the SUNY New Paltz St. Hawks in the Keating Sports Center. The non-conference season opener is set to start at 3:00 p.m.

Overall, the Hawks are scheduled to play 9 home games, including a tri-match on March 10-11, and 18 away games. On February 8, the Hawks begin Northern Athletics Collegiate Conference (NACC) play when they hit the road to take on MSOE. 

Head coach Mike Oswald had the following to say about the upcoming season: "We are very excited about the 2023 volleyball season! We have another very competitive calendar. This year we open at home on our new court against New Paltz! The NACC is strong again and we'll have a much more experienced team going into the season! We're really looking forward to showing our growth in our conference and region in 2023!"

The 2023 team welcomes three newcomers, and brings back 11 returners. Michal Markevych led the team in kills last season, picking up 203 for a 2.71 kills per set percentage. Markevych also led the Hawks with 22 service aces. Alec Donald was the dig leader last season, recording a total of 191 digs for 2.69 digs per set.
